Hair Type Suitability
Because the convenience of TSA‑friendly solid bars can seem universal, you’ll find that the right fit hinges on your hair’s specific needs. Fine to medium‑weight strands respond best to gentle cleansing bars that don’t strip natural oils—so choose formulas with mild surfactants. Oily scalps work well with lightweight humectants that lift excess oil while leaving minimal residue for coarse hair. Dry or damaged textures demand bars rich in shea, argan, glycerin, or panthenol to lock in moisture and tame frizz. Color‑treated hair deserves pH‑balanced, sulfate‑free bars that preserve pigment and softness. Curly, kinky, or coiled styles thrive on moisturizing bars with higher oil ratios and lower surfactant concentrations, boosting definition without drying out. Try testing samples to spot the best match for your routine.

Can I Use Solid Shampoo on Color‑Treated Hair?
Yes, you can use solid shampoo on color‑treated hair. Most bars are sulfate‑free, so they’re gentle and won’t strip pigment. They also contain conditioning agents that help lock in color. Just be sure to choose a bar with mild ingredients, avoid added perfumes known to fade dye, and rinse thoroughly. With regular use, your colored locks will stay vibrant and silky and maintain their shine every day over time together.
